Responsibilities

  • Conduct thorough inspections and diagnostics on heavy equipment including excavators, cranes, forklifts, tractors, and other construction machinery.
  • Perform repairs on diesel engines, transmissions, hydraulics, electrical systems, brakes, suspensions, and HVAC systems to ensure machinery operates efficiently and safely.
  • Utilize schematics and technical manuals to troubleshoot complex issues related to heavy equipment operation and mechanical failures.
  • Carry out fabrication tasks such as welding, assembly, and modifications to meet operational requirements or OEM specifications.
  • Maintain detailed service records, complete repair reports, and document all maintenance activities accurately.
  • Assist in equipment troubleshooting during breakdowns or malfunctions to minimize downtime and maximize productivity.
  • Support customer service efforts by providing technical advice or explanations regarding equipment repairs and maintenance needs.
